I don't have a proper solution for you as of yet, but here's something you can try in the meantime that might help:
Open the CSV file in a text editor and do a search-and-replace of
,,
with
,"",
Thus, you'll change
0001,Title,Description,,Item,,,Item
into
0001,Title,Description,"",Item,"","",Item
...which should work.
You may need to repeat the search-and-replace to catch all the double commas.
Note that if you have any double commas in legitimate strings, such as
0001,Title,"My favourite punctuation characters are the comma,, doublecomma,, and the semi-colon.",,Item,,,Item
...you'll need to manually fix that line because after you do the search-and-replace, you'll have a line that isn't valid CSV:
0001,Title,"My favourite punctuation characters are the comma,"", doublecomma,"", and the semi-colon.","",Item,"","",Item
